2015
DOI: 10.1007/978-3-319-23063-4_23
|View full text |Cite
|
Sign up to set email alerts
|

BPMN Task Instance Streaming for Efficient Micro-task Crowdsourcing Processes

Abstract: Abstract. The Business Process Model and Notation (BPMN) is a standard for modeling and executing business processes with human or machine tasks. The semantics of tasks is usually discrete: a task has exactly one start event and one end event; for multi-instance tasks, all instances must complete before an end event is emitted. We propose a new task type and streaming connector for crowdsourcing able to run hundreds or thousands of micro-task instances in parallel. The two constructs provide for task streaming… Show more

Help me understand this report

Search citation statements

Order By: Relevance

Paper Sections

Select...
1
1
1
1

Citation Types

0
7
0

Year Published

2016
2016
2019
2019

Publication Types

Select...
2
2
1

Relationship

0
5

Authors

Journals

citations
Cited by 6 publications
(7 citation statements)
references
References 16 publications
0
7
0
Order By: Relevance
“…The design that hides the detail topology and communication at the edge network may cause the process designer unable to properly define the behaviours and processes of the devices in terms of adding participants, modifying or customising the processes, react to or prevent failures and so on. Further, recent IoT management systems often involve edge nodes as a part of the BPMS in the scenarios such as logistics [22], crowdsourcing processes [26], HVAC system [19], health care services [20], Ambient Assisted Living [27], real-time sensing [28] where mobile and wireless network objects are involved.…”
Section: Problem Statementmentioning
confidence: 99%
See 4 more Smart Citations
“…The design that hides the detail topology and communication at the edge network may cause the process designer unable to properly define the behaviours and processes of the devices in terms of adding participants, modifying or customising the processes, react to or prevent failures and so on. Further, recent IoT management systems often involve edge nodes as a part of the BPMS in the scenarios such as logistics [22], crowdsourcing processes [26], HVAC system [19], health care services [20], Ambient Assisted Living [27], real-time sensing [28] where mobile and wireless network objects are involved.…”
Section: Problem Statementmentioning
confidence: 99%
“…Generally, in this approach, the system relies on the middleware technologies to translate the BP model to the executable code, then send the code to the IoT devices for execution. Particularly, numerous BPMS4IoT frameworks [22,91,92,19,26] have utilised this approach to enable IoT/WSN devices participating in BP execution without the need of embedding complex software middleware components (e.g., workflow engine) on the devices. Figure 6c).…”
Section: Process Execution Approachesmentioning
confidence: 99%
See 3 more Smart Citations